The power to possess continuously increasing strength. Not be confused with Absolute Strength.

Also Called

  • Ever Increasing Strength
  • Strength Infinity

Capabilities

User has strength that increases over time without limit to how strong they can become and can increase their strength for essentially forever. This makes their potential for strength limitless and immeasurable, allowing them to perform any feat of strength in time. With training users can learn to control their might to helps them in situations that require greater strength.

Applications

Associations

Limitations

  • Increases in strength could unbalance other physical attributes, such as speed, causing the user's condition to degrade or collapse.
  • May need to commit a certain action or fulfill a certain condition for their strength to increase.
  • Users may gain a level of strength so great that it causes catastrophe.
  • May be weak against Downgrading.
  • Strength increases without limit, but is still finite at any point in time. Absolute Strength can overcome this power.
  • User can still be contained or impeded by obstacles, if their current strength level is too low to overcome them.
